Truth Tables in discrete mathematics course,
in this course we delve into the fundamental concepts of Boolean algebra and logic. Truth tables are essential tools used to analyze and represent logical relationships between variables. In this course, you will explore how truth tables systematically display all possible truth values of logical expressions, enabling clear understanding of logical operations such as conjunction, disjunction, negation, and implication. By mastering truth tables, you'll gain insights into evaluating the validity and consistency of complex logical statements. This foundational knowledge is crucial for fields ranging from computer science to mathematics and philosophy.
